Most Cavalier owners contact their breeder directly if they can’t keep their dog for any reason, and the breeder will take the dog back and, if possible, rehome him/her. Very often, they are not suitable for a home with young children. They are usually older dogs and sometimes they will have health concerns. The Club averages only one or two dogs per year that need to be rehomed. Cavaliers come into Rescue for many reasons but often it is an older person, who is no long able to care for their pet. These are just some of the reasons Cavaliers are rescued. Rescue Cavaliers come from a variety of places – from shelters, owner surrenders due to the economy and loss of jobs, owner health issues or even owner death, legal siezures, or commercial breeders.
